Πρόγραμμα JavaScript για δημιουργία πολλών γραμμών

Σε αυτό το παράδειγμα, θα μάθετε να γράφετε ένα πρόγραμμα JavaScript που θα δημιουργήσει πολύχρωμες συμβολοσειρές.

Για να κατανοήσετε αυτό το παράδειγμα, θα πρέπει να γνωρίζετε τις ακόλουθες ενότητες προγραμματισμού JavaScript:

  • Συμβολοσειρά JavaScript
  • Λογοτεχνία προτύπων JavaScript (συμβολοσειρές προτύπων)

Παράδειγμα 1: Δημιουργία συμβολοσειρών πολλαπλών γραμμών χρησιμοποιώντας το +

 // program to create a multiline strings // using the + operator const message = 'This is a long message' + 'that spans across multiple lines' + 'in the code.' console.log(message);

Παραγωγή

 Αυτό είναι ένα μεγάλο μήνυμα που εκτείνεται σε πολλές γραμμές στον κώδικα.

Στο παραπάνω παράδειγμα, δημιουργείται μια σειρά πολλαπλών +γραμμών χρησιμοποιώντας τον τελεστή και .

Ο χαρακτήρας διαφυγής χρησιμοποιείται για να σπάσει τη γραμμή.

Παράδειγμα 2: Δημιουργία πολλών γραμμών χρησιμοποιώντας

 // program to create a multiline strings // using the operator const message = 'This is a long message that spans across multiple lines in the code.' console.log(message);

Παραγωγή

 Αυτό είναι ένα μεγάλο μήνυμα που εκτείνεται σε πολλές γραμμές στον κώδικα.

Στο παραπάνω παράδειγμα, δημιουργείται μια συμβολοσειρά πολλαπλών γραμμών χρησιμοποιώντας . χρησιμοποιείται για να σπάσει τη γραμμή.

Παράδειγμα 3: Δημιουργία πολυγραμμικών συμβολοσειρών χρησιμοποιώντας το πρότυπο Literal

 // program to create a multiline strings // using the template literal const message = `This is a long message that spans across multiple lines in the code.` console.log(message);

Παραγωγή

 Αυτό είναι ένα μεγάλο μήνυμα που εκτείνεται σε πολλές γραμμές στον κώδικα.

Στο παραπάνω παράδειγμα, το πρότυπο κυριολεκτικά ` `χρησιμοποιείται για τη σύνταξη πολλών γραμμών.

Το πρότυπο literal εισήχθη στη νεότερη έκδοση του JavaScript ( ES6 ).

Ορισμένα προγράμματα περιήγησης ενδέχεται να μην υποστηρίζουν τη χρήση προτύπων. Για να μάθετε περισσότερα, επισκεφτείτε τη Γραμματική υποστήριξη προτύπων JavaScript.

ενδιαφέροντα άρθρα...